    E-Wallets: The Speed Kings of Casino Banking

    Regarding speed, e-wallets are the Ferraris of online casino payment methods. Platforms like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ller have transformed the withdrawal landscape with their quick processing times. Once the casino clears your winnings, which can happen in a blink, the money zips into your e-wallet account almost instantly.

    So, why are e-wallets so speedy? It’s all in their design. These platforms are built for online transactions. They operate on the principle of immediate transfers, allowing them to process payments faster than most bank transactions. Plus, they’re secure and user-friendly, adding to their appeal.

    However, it’s not all sunshine and rainbows. Sometimes, while the casino processes withdrawals quickly, transferring your money from the e-wallet to your bank account can add a day or two to your wait. Yet, even with this slight delay, e-wallets remain the top dog for those who prioritize speed.

    Cryptocurrencies: The Up-and-Coming Contenders

    The new kids on the block—c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in—are making waves in the instant withdrawal scene. Known for their decentralization, these digital currencies offer anonymity and security, a big draw for online gamblers.

    The real kicker? Once a casino processes your withdrawal request, the funds can appear in your crypto wallet in minutes. This lightning-fast speed is due to the lack of traditional banking checks and balances in crypto transactions, which often slows down other payment methods.

    Despite these perks, diving into cryptocurrencies can be daunting for newbies. The value of these currencies can swing wildly, which might affect how much you withdraw in fiat currency terms. Yet, for those willing to ride the crypto wave, the speed of transactions can be incredibly rewarding.

    Credit and Debit Cards: The Familiar Faces with a Twist

    Credit and debit cards are the go-to payment methods for many online casino enthusiasts. They are tried and tested. Virtually everyone has one, and they are accepted at almost every online casino. When it comes to instant withdrawals, however, they can be a mixed bag.

    Typically, casinos process card withdrawals within a few hours to a few days, which isn’t too shabby. But here’s the rub: once the casino sends your money out, the banks take over, and this is where things can slow down. It can take a couple of days to a full week for the funds to appear in your account.

    Despite this, many players stick with cards because they trust them. They’re familiar, straightforward, and don’t require setting up another account, as with e-wallets or crypto wallets. For many, this convenience and security is worth the wait.

    Navigating the Risks: Safe and Responsible Betting Practices

    In the vibrant world of sports betting, keeping a cool head and practicing responsible gambling is essential. In Arkansas, as in many places where betting is legal, mechanisms help gamblers stay in control. Understanding and utilizing these tools can make sports betting fun and safe.

    First and foremost, always set a budget for your betting activities and stick to it. It’s easy to get carried away with the excitement, especially during big games or events, but remember that betting should not impact your financial stability. Many sportsbooks offer tools to limit your deposits and wagers, which can be a helpful way to manage your spending.

    Additionally, being aware of the signs of problem gambling is crucial. If you find yourself betting more than you can afford, chasing losses, or gambling affecting your relationships and responsibilities, it might be time to seek help. Arkansas provides resources for gambling addiction, including hotlines and support groups, to assist anyone struggling with these issues.
